Your new hosts, Stevie Hurst and AJ Matuchniak, with the first podcast ever for Arsenal In My Blood. Talking to you about how we fell in love for Arsenal, how the Youth Academy and Women’s teams are getting on, Özil’s poor injury record and best position, Shad’s influence on Arsenal’s injury problems or lack thereof, Walcott’s much awaited comeback and possible goal in the predictions hmmmm?, and Wilshere watching Xabi Alonso videos and the possibility of him being a defensive playmaker. Round the Arsenal In My Blood podcast with shoutouts, twitter accounts, and predictions of the upcoming games. See you guys next week!
